The Austrocephalocereus purpureus stands out as a striking purple cactus known for its slender, columnar form. This species showcases a rich purple hue that deepens as the plant matures, making it a captivating specimen for collectors. Native to South America, this cactus thrives in arid environments and offers a unique visual appeal due to its vivid coloration and elegant stature.
The Austrocephalocereus purpureus HU133 is a notable member of the Austrocephalocereus species group. People admire it for its rarity and distinctive morphology, which includes ribbed stems and subtle spines that add texture without overwhelming its graceful appearance. Garden enthusiasts prize this rare cactus species for its ability to bring exotic flair and vertical interest to any collection.
The purpureus cactus is an excellent example of a South American cactus that combines beauty with adaptability. Its rare status and unique color make it a prized addition to cactus collections worldwide. Whether grown indoors or outdoors, this columnar cactus draws attention and admiration for its distinctive look and elegant form.
